Key Facts
- Soyokaze no Kuchizuke's instance of is recorded as single[2].
- Soyokaze no Kuchizuke's genre is J-pop[3].
- Soyokaze no Kuchizuke followed Anata ni Muchū[4].
- Soyokaze no Kuchizuke was followed by Abunai Doyōbi[5].
- Soyokaze no Kuchizuke was performed by Candies[6].
- Soyokaze no Kuchizuke's record label is recorded as Sony Music Entertainment Japan[7].
- Soyokaze no Kuchizuke was published on January 21, 1974[8].
- Soyokaze no Kuchizuke's single taken from the album or EP is recorded as Abunai Doyōbi: Candies no Sekai[9].
